Liability

Liability is typically one of the most pressing problems that arise from an accident involving a truck. If you've been injured because of the negligence of another driver, you can seek compensation through a lawsuit. But, it's not always straightforward to identify who caused the accident. An attorney that specializes in truck accidents can assist you to identify the culprit and hold them accountable for your loss.

In some instances an attorney who represents victims of accidents could hold a truck's manufacturer, mechanics and maintenance crews responsible for the lack of maintenance or improper loading of cargo. Trucking company, truck driver or truck parts distributor could also be held accountable. Other cases may involve a government entity such as a bridge, road or other infrastructure.

An attorney for truck accidents can also gather evidence to prove the cause of the accident. He or she can obtain police reports photographs of the scene of the crash, and witness statements to aid in building a strong case. These documents will establish who was at fault. This means that an attorney who handles truck accidents will maximize the chances of getting an appropriate settlement.

Truck accident attorneys may sue the truck's manufacturer and the manufacturer of the truck, to hold them responsible in the event of a truck crash because of a flaw in the truck's design. Even if the truck owner did all he could to keep the truck in good condition but defective parts could cause accidents. Incorrect loading can make the truck unstable and result in an accident. If the trucking company is negligent in the hiring or supervision of a driver, it may also be responsible for the accident. The driver of the truck may be held accountable for the accident even if it happened even though he was not on duty.

In some instances, the trucking company is in a sense vicariously responsible for the crash. The driver could be distracted while driving, did not follow the rules of the road, or had a drink while driving. The trucking company may also be held accountable in other situations where the driver worked more than the 11 hours limit per shift.
